WebA visa – if you are subject to the French visa regime. Proof of sufficient funds for your intended stay in France. France wants you to show evidence of attesting 120€ per day if holding no proof of prepaid accommodation and 65€ per day in the other case. A round-trip ticket to France and back.

In the UK (England, Wales, Scotland, Northern Ireland, the Isle of Wight, the Isle of Man, the Bailiwicks of Jersey, Guernsey, Gibraltar and the Falkland Islands) visas applications to go to France are processed by the French Consulate General in London where all decisions are taken.. … the sea and me quilt patternWebApr 8, 2024 · UK visa free process for French cirizens is straightforward and simple.
